Apple i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2021) is slightly better than the Apple i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2020), getting a general score of 91.1 against 84.6. The Apple i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2021) design is newer, but a bit heavier and a bit thicker than the Apple i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2020). Both of these tablets come with iPadOS OS (operating system), but the Apple i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2021) has a more recent 14.x version while Apple i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2020) has iPadOS 13.x version.
The i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2021) counts with a bit faster CPU than Apple i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2020), and although they both have 8 cores, the i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2021) also has a higher amount of RAM memory. The i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2021) features a little more vivid display than Apple i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2020), and although they both have the same exact 2048 x 2732 pixels resolution, a screen of the same size and the same pixel density, the i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2021) also has a lot brighter display.
The Apple i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2020) and Apple i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2021) count with incredibly similar storage for games and applications, both of them have exactly the same internal memory capacity. IPad Pro 12.9-inch (2021) has just a little better battery life than i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2020), because it has an 11 percent more battery capacity.
IPad Pro 12.9-inch (2020) and Apple i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2021) both count with incredibly similar cameras, both have the same 60 frames per second video frame rate, the same aperture, the same (4K) video quality and a same resolution camera in the back.
IPad Pro 12.9-inch (2021) costs a bit more than the i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2020), but it's still a great choice, as you can get a lot more features for that extra money.
